Sinossi

While experimenting with a magic wand, two young brothers are pulled into a computer game called The Fight for Magicallus.
 
In the land of Magicallus, they encounter goblins and knights who are on the brink of war because their ruler has mysteriously disappeared. The knights blame the goblins, and the boys learn of a frightening prophecy that foretells the end of Magicallus. They must find an ancient book hidden in a dragon's lair before the prophecy comes to pass and they are all destroyed.
 
Can the boys find their way home? Will the knights and goblins go to war, or will the dragon destroy them all?
 
A fast-paced adventure filled with humor and suspense, The Fight For Magicallus is an exciting fantasy tale for readers of all ages.

    One hundred years ago, a mysterious and alarming illness spread across America's South, striking tens of thousands of victims. No one knew what caused it or how to treat it. People were left weak, disfigured, insane, and in some cases, dead. Award-winning science and history writer Gail Jarrow tracks this disease, commonly known as pellagra, and highlights how doctors, scientists, and public health officials finally defeated it. Illustrated with 100 archival photographs, Red Madness includes stories about real-life pellagra victims and accounts of scientific investigations. It concludes with a glossary, timeline, further resources, author's note, bibliography, and index. This book is perfect to share with young readers looking for a historical perspective of the Covid-19/Coronavirus pandemic that is gripping the world today.
